测试电脑软件:全面评估软件的性能与质量
一、引言
随着科技的快速发展,电脑软件已经成为我们日常生活和工作中不可或缺的一部分。为了确保软件的性能和质量,对其进行全面测试显得尤为重要。本文将围绕电脑软件的测试进行深入探讨,涵盖软件功能、兼容性、性能、安全性以及用户界面等方面。
二、软件功能测试
软件功能测试旨在验证软件是否满足设计要求,实现所需的功能。测试内容应包括基本功能、核心流程以及辅助功能。例如,对于一款办公软件,需要测试文档编辑、表格制作、幻灯片演示等基本功能。还需验证软件的异常处理能力,如数据备份、恢复以及错误提示等功能。
三、兼容性测试
兼容性测试主要关注软件在不同操作系统、不同硬件配置以及不同浏览器上的运行情况。测试人员需确保软件能在主流操作系统(如Widows、MacOS、Liux)上正常运行,同时也要考虑不同版本的操作系统。还需测试软件在不同CPU、内存和硬盘配置的计算机上的运行效果。浏览器兼容性测试也是必不可少的环节,以确保软件在各类浏览器上提供一致的用户体验。
四、性能测试
性能测试关注软件的响应速度、数据传输速率以及资源利用率等方面。测试人员应模拟大量用户同时使用软件的情况,以检测软件的负载能力和稳定性。例如,对于一款网络会议软件,需要测试其在多用户同时在线时的音频、视频传输质量及延迟情况。还需关注软件在运行过程中的CPU、内存占用情况,以确保其高效运行。
五、安全性测试
安全性测试旨在评估软件在面临各种安全威胁时的表现。测试人员需验证软件的加密算法、数据传输安全以及用户身份验证等安全措施的有效性。例如,对一款在线银行软件进行安全测试时,需要重点检查其在处理敏感信息(如用户密码)时的加密措施是否足够强大,防止数据泄露。还需测试软件在面临网络攻击(如SQL注入、跨站脚本攻击)时的防御能力。
六、用户界面测试
用户界面测试关注软件的易用性和美观度。测试人员应从用户的角度出发,检查软件的布局、文字和图标是否清晰易懂。还需验证软件的交互设计和动画效果是否符合用户期望。例如,对于一款儿童教育软件,其用户界面应充满趣味性且易于儿童理解。对于一款生产力工具,其用户界面应提供直观的操作方式和快捷的常用功能。
七、结论
通过本文对电脑软件的全面测试分析,我们可以看出软件测试在确保软件性能和质量方面具有重要作用。在实际测试过程中,应根据软件的特性和需求进行针对性的测试。通过有效的软件测试,可以降低软件故障率,提高用户体验,为软件的成功发布奠定坚实基础。因此,我们应重视软件测试工作,确保软件的质量和稳定性达到用户期望的标准。
标题:电脑测试软件
链接:https://yqqlyw.com/news/xydt/1781.html
版权:文章转载自网络,如有侵权,请联系删除!